Exploring Different Material Choices



Choosing the ideal material is an essential aspect of picking scrubs, as it directly impacts convenience, efficiency, and total complete satisfaction. Numerous textile options are readily available, each offering special benefits. Cotton is preferred for its breathability and gentleness, making it a prominent choice, particularly in warmer environments. Polyester blends offer enhanced durability and crease resistance, making them suitable for long changes. Additionally, moisture-wicking materials are suitable for medical care professionals that require to remain completely dry and comfortable throughout requiring tasks. Spandex or elastane blends supply stretch, enabling ease of movement, which is necessary in a busy medical care setting. In addition, antimicrobial treatments in some fabrics can aid minimize the risk of infection, an essential factor to consider in medical settings. Eventually, recognizing the qualities of each fabric kind allows healthcare workers to make informed decisions that align with their specific needs and choices.

Cleaning Directions



Correct cleaning directions are critical for prolonging the life of medical scrubs. Medical care experts must adhere to the care classifies supplied by manufacturers, as these commonly have essential details on cleaning temperatures and cycle setups. Generally, scrubs must be laundered in warm water to properly get rid of bacteria and smells while preserving textile honesty. Utilizing a mild detergent can help in maintaining the shade and appearance of the textile. It is suggested to avoid bleach, as it can deteriorate the material in time. Furthermore, scrubs ought to be air-dried or tumble-dried on a reduced warmth readying to protect against shrinkage. By sticking to these cleaning standards, healthcare workers can guarantee their scrubs continue to be comfy and long lasting throughout their requiring careers.


Discolor Elimination Tips



Keeping the tidiness of clinical scrubs surpasses fundamental washing; discolor elimination methods play a considerable duty in maintaining their appearance and longevity. Medical care professionals ought to promptly resolve discolorations, as allowing them sit can make elimination extra tough. For fresh discolorations, blot instead of scrub to avoid dispersing. A mix of light cleaning agent and water can properly treat common stains, while specialized discolor cleaners may be essential for tougher marks like blood or ink. Constantly examine any type of cleansing service on a little, unnoticeable area first to prevent staining. Additionally, saturating scrubs in cold water prior to washing can assist loosen stubborn spots. Correct stain elimination not just improves the scrub's appearance yet likewise prolongs its lifespan, making it an important aspect of care.


Storage Recommendations



Effective storage of medical scrubs is important for preserving their high quality and prolonging their life-span. To attain this, scrubs should be washed and dried appropriately before storage space, guaranteeing all discolorations are removed and dampness is eliminated. It is recommended to keep scrubs in an amazing, completely dry place, far from direct sunshine, which can cause fading. Hanging scrubs on cushioned hangers can aid preserve their shape and protect against wrinkles, while folding them nicely in a cabinet can save room. Stay clear of congestion, as this can cause creasing and damage. Additionally, making use of breathable garment bags can secure scrubs from dirt and pests. By complying with these storage suggestions, medical care experts can keep their scrubs looking fresh and useful for longer periods.

Just how Typically Should I Change My Scrubs?



Experts advise changing scrubs every six to twelve months, depending on deterioration. Routine evaluations for fading, fraying, or stains aid figure out when updates are necessary to keep expertise and hygiene criteria in health care settings.


Are There Certain Scrubs for Different Medical Specialties?



Different clinical specialties often need details scrub styles, shades, and functionalities. Medical teams might like darker tones for stain camouflage, while pediatric medicines could use lively shades to create an inviting environment for youngsters.

What Are the Environmental Effects of Scrub Materials?



The environmental impacts of scrub products vary significantly. Natural fibers decay quicker, while synthetic products can add to pollution and waste. Lasting manufacturing techniques are progressively crucial for minimizing the environmental footprint of medical scrubs.
